Abstract
The article focuses on the energy efficiency issue and the negative impact on the environment of Cloud computing based on data centers infrastructure. A modernization of Cloud architecture in terms of Green computing is proposed, using FPGA hardware accelerators and distributed peer-to-peer networks. Customer and FPGA as a Service (FAAS) interaction scenarios are discussed. A distributed peer-to-peer Cloud architecture is suggested. The energy efficiency analysis of the proposed architectures shows its advantages.
